Java BeanUtils.getProperties для Необязательный - PullRequest
0 голосов
/ 23 октября 2018

У меня есть мой класс как

class MyClass {
   Optional<String> field;
}

В моем пользовательском валидаторе я использую BeanUtils, чтобы получить свойство, используя

final String value = BeanUtils.getProperty(object, 'field');

Но это преобразуется встрока Optional[the-value], и я не могу снова привести это значение к Optional<String>.Это возможно?

...